Why did Queen Elizabeth became queen and not her mother?

Elizabeth was born into royalty as the daughter of the second son of King George V. After her uncle Edward VIII abdicated in 1936 (subsequently becoming duke of Windsor), her father became King George VI, and she became heir presumptive. Elizabeth assumed the title of queen upon her father’s death in 1952.

Why was Princess Margaret cremated not buried?

PRINCESS Margaret wanted to be cremated because she found the alternative Royal burial ground “gloomy”, a life-long friend said last night. Instead, she preferred the Royal Crypt at St George’s Chapel in the grounds of Windsor Castle, where her father King George VI is buried.

Did the Queen Mother use a wheelchair?

She suffered from a painful hip, which brought her to virtual immobility and eventually necessitated the occasional private use of a wheelchair (which she much disliked).
